Abstract
Petrol engines oil, water sprays alone, synchronous working technique which the integrated control circuit controls the electrical appliance and mechanical movement of the whole water atomization plant. The water tank added with the special processed water supply the water for the high-frequency oscillated atomizer through the pump, the inlet electromagnetic valve and the inlet pipe. The water atomized extremely go into the air inlet pipe through the connecting pipe and inlet interface and mix with the oil vapor to enter burning room by the piston vacuum suction downlink (the internal combustion engine with the carburetor structure) or sprayed by the spraying nozzle (EFI Engine). After the spark plug ignition, the water molecule can generate much oxygen in the high temperature and high pressure to supply the fuel combustion. So the combustion engine can output the biggest power at the same fuel. The pollution of the discharged gas is inhibited because the water fog burning in the mixing gas. The power supply of the integrated control circuit is provided by the starting power of the gasoline engine.

Summary of the invention:
For realizing the reliable and stable working condition of gasoline engine, the combustion-assistance technology scheme that it is gasoline engine that this patent has adopted through special finished water.Oil, water is individual atomization respectively, supplies with the gasoline engine firing chamber synchronously.At the gasoline mixture body of firing chamber in a flash by spark ignitor, rapid oxidation and produce a large amount of oxygen under the high temperature of the burned chamber of water molecule of high atomisation (greater than 500 degree Celsius) and the environment of high pressure (greater than 25Mpa), impel oil molecule fully to burn, the peak output that internal-combustion engine is obtained under the equal oil mass is exported.

Embodiment:
Regulate and control the electrical equipment and the machinery action of whole water atomization plant by integrated control circuitry.After water tank adds special finished water, by water pump, entering water electromagnetic valve, intake pipe supply high frequency vibration atomizer with the atomizing of water electrode degree after, again by connecting tube and intake interface, enter intake manifold, enter the firing chamber synchronously by the descending pull of vacuum of internal combustion engine (internal-combustion engine of carburetor structure) or through oil injecting nozzle injection (EFI formula internal-combustion engine) with oily mixed gas.Behind the spark ignitor mixed gas, water molecule produces a large amount of oxygen under High Temperature High Pressure, and the fuel feeding molecule fully burns.The peak output that internal-combustion engine is obtained under the equal oil mass is exported.Because the combustion process of the participation mixing gas of water smoke, it is discharged the gaseous contamination situation and has also obtained inhibition to a great extent.Wherein, the power supply of integrated control circuitry is provided by the starting power supply of gasoline engine.
The technical program has overcome the crude defective of water source quality well, has improved the atomization quality of water molecule, has got rid of the technology barrier that continues to provide vaporific gas synchronously, has solved oxygen enriching burning-aid working procedure oily, the water cofiring satisfactoryly.
Other:
The technical program is through experimental the travelling of golden cup 6480A1 station wagon (manually ripple, carburetor structure) and benz SE-300 sedan car (automatic ripple, EFI structure) (the golden cup 15000KM that travelled; The benz 3000KM that travelled) be proved to be after: implement the gasoline engine after the technical program, starting rapidly, the no abnormal shake of internal-combustion engine during idle running, vehicle quickens powerful, speed-raising is fast.When middle and high speed was travelled, all were working properly for internal-combustion engine, and starting difficulty or auto extinguishing fault did not take place.The oil consumption of golden cup car on average reduces more than 20%; The oil consumption of benz car reduces on average more than 30%.Simultaneously, the discharge quality of tail gas also obviously improves.
In addition, the technical program need not be changed and can implement all gasoline engines original structure.
